@@ -369,10 +369,29 @@ static int cafe_smbus_write_data(struct cafe_camera *cam,
        rval = value | ((command << TWSIC1_ADDR_SHIFT) & TWSIC1_ADDR);
        cafe_reg_write(cam, REG_TWSIC1, rval);
        spin_unlock_irqrestore(&cam->dev_lock, flags);
-       msleep(2); /* Required or things flake */
 
+       /*
+        * Time to wait for the write to complete.  THIS IS A RACY
+        * WAY TO DO IT, but the sad fact is that reading the TWSIC1
+        * register too quickly after starting the operation sends
+        * the device into a place that may be kinder and better, but
+        * which is absolutely useless for controlling the sensor.  In
+        * practice we have plenty of time to get into our sleep state
+        * before the interrupt hits, and the worst case is that we
+        * time out and then see that things completed, so this seems
+        * the best way for now.
+        */
+       do {
+               prepare_to_wait(&cam->smbus_wait, &the_wait,
+                               TASK_UNINTERRUPTIBLE);
+               schedule_timeout(1); /* even 1 jiffy is too long */
+               finish_wait(&cam->smbus_wait, &the_wait);
+       } while (!cafe_smbus_write_done(cam));
+
+#ifdef IF_THE_CAFE_HARDWARE_WORKED_RIGHT
        wait_event_timeout(cam->smbus_wait, cafe_smbus_write_done(cam),
                        CAFE_SMBUS_TIMEOUT);
+#endif
        spin_lock_irqsave(&cam->dev_lock, flags);
        rval = cafe_reg_read(cam, REG_TWSIC1);
        spin_unlock_irqrestore(&cam->dev_lock, flags);
